Jennifer Pariser, the head of litigation for Sony BMG, seems to believe that if you rip a CD that you bought, you are stealing music:

Making “a copy” of a purchased song is just “a nice way of saying ‘steals just one copy’,” she said.

And she added:

“It’s my personal belief that Sony BMG is half the size now as it was in 2000.”
